By the editors · 2 min readBlack pepper snaps open with dry incense crackle that immediately coats the air in papery ash. Frankincense thickens the pepper, turning its heat into a resinous haze that prepares the runway for the heart. Leather arrives as a matte hide brushed with smoked ginger, the spice quietly glowing inside the skin rather than shouting. Sandalwood enters late as a blond, lactonic wood that softens the tarry seams of the leather and lets the musk puff the scent into a hazy, second-skin aura. Wear it projects arm-length for five hours, then settles to a suede whisper perfect for cool urban evenings, travel, or layering under a wool coat.
